In yet another blow to PML N, two top leaders join PTI
ISLAMABAD, MAR 15 (DNA) – In yet another blow to the ruling PML N two of its top leaders from Islamabad have joined PTI today.
Media coordinator and senior vice president from PML-N Islamabad and PML-N Islamabad senior vice president on Wednesday joined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) following a meeting with PTIChairperson Imran Khan at Bani Galah.
Tariq Dildar Chaudhry a PML-N Islamabad media coordinator and Raja Tahir Nawaz senior vice president Islamabad region have announced to quit PML-N and join PTI in the presence of central leadership of PTI .
During the meeting both the PML-N leaders expressed their confidence on the PTI leadership and it’s manifesto.
Imran Khan warmly welcomed the new affiliates and termed their join up as “vital addition” in the party. “It will further strengthen the party (PTI) in Islamabad” he asserted.
